Swiss-Prot: 82% identical to RHAT_PECAS: L-rhamnose-proton symporter (rhaT) from Pectobacterium atrosepticum (strain SCRI 1043 / ATCC BAA-672)

KEGG orthology group: K02856, L-rhamnose-H+ transport protein (inferred from 100% identity to rah:Rahaq_3840)

MetaCyc: 76% identical to rhamnose/lyxose:H+ symporter (Escherichia coli K-12 substr. MG1655)
